Temperatures are rising as spring winds down, but there will be no lazy lolling on the beach for would-be home buyers this summer, judging by the state of home buying in the U.S. in May. Driven by an ever-scarcer supply of available homes, prices for residential real estate reached new heights in May—and homes were scooped swiftly off the market by a lucky few among the hordes of wannabe buyers. Santa Cruz was the 11th hottest market in the nation. Read the details |
